What Voltage My Solar Panel Produces (Calculations + Examples)

Estimating Voc and Vmp Value For a Panel. 24 volt panel; 24 volts x 0.8 = 18 volts; 24 volts + 18 volts = 42 Voc; 24 volt panel; 24 volts x 0.2 = 4.8 volts; 24 volts + 4.8 volts = 28.8 Vmp; If you measure the voltage of a panel that is not connected to any load and is in full sun you should measure the Voc value.

150 watt Solar Panel: How Many Amps (Specifications, Power Output

A 12v 150 watt solar panel will produce about 18.3 volts and 8.2 amps under ideal sunlight conditions. (inc. 1kw/m 2 of sunlight intensity, no wind, and 25 o C temperature). What is a typical open circuit voltage of a solar panel?

To be more accurate, a typical open circuit voltage of a solar cell is 0.58 volts (at 77°F or 25°C). All the PV cells in all solar panels have the same 0.58V voltage. Because we connect them in series, the total output voltage is the sum of the voltages of individual PV cells. Within the solar panel, the PV cells are wired in series.
